Jefferies analyst Laurence Alexander downgraded Green Plains (GPRE) to Hold from Buy with a price target of $6, down from $14. The firm reduced estimates to reflect likely pressure on the company’s ethanol and protein margins. Ethanol margins will likely “remain negative for longer” on lower ethanol and higher input prices, the analyst tells investors in a research note. Jefferies downgraded Green Plains to reflect the confluence of policy risk, cyclical headwinds, and strategic uncertainty following the recent CEO departure.
